A quality chemist is a professional responsible for ensuring the quality and safety of chemical products and processes. They work in various industries such as pharmaceuticals, food and beverage, cosmetics, and manufacturing. The primary role of a quality chemist is to conduct quality control tests and inspections on raw materials, intermediate products, and final products to ensure they meet the required standards and specifications. They analyze samples using various techniques such as chromatography, spectroscopy, and wet chemistry methods. Quality chemists also develop and implement quality assurance protocols, maintain accurate documentation of test results, troubleshoot any quality issues, and collaborate with other departments to improve product quality and efficiency. Strong analytical skills, attention to detail, and knowledge of regulatory requirements are essential for this occupation.

Quality Chemist salary in India
Average Yearly Salary of Quality Chemist in India is approximately 2,120,301 INR (23,464 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.
